!cc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ccccc
!c    PURPOSE:
!c 
!c       MAIN PROGRAM TO POST PROCESSING OF THE ETSS GRIDDED DATA
!c
!c    ARGUMENTS:
!c    
!c       POST PROCESSING OF THE ETSS OUTPUT DATA READ DATA FROM SSGRID.xxx AND 
!c       MERGED INTO NDFD HOURLY GRIB2 FILES SKIP THE HALF HOUR RECORDS 
!c
!c       METHOD: DIVIDE THIS INTO THREE CATEGORIES
!c         (1) Extract surge values from tropical grids,extra-tropical grids
!c             and merged into CONUS grids in 2.5km (East Coast, 
!c             GULF of Mexico, NEP/West Coast)
!c         (2) Extract surge values from extropical grids  and merged into ALSKA 
!c             grids in 3km (BBC,GULF of AK/NEP grids)
!c         (3) Extract surge values from tropical grids,extra-tropical grids
!c             and merged into CONUS grids in 625m (East Coast and
!c             GULF of Mexico)
!c
